How to solve this problem?HP-Unix rp8400
Dear All
I made a partion on HP-UNIX Server rp8400 to two nodes node1 and node2 and every node has it's own ethernet port and ip address , the ip address's are on the same network and they have the same subnet.
The problem that i can ping node1 but i can not ping node2 i check the lan of node2 i found it disabled i enabled again inorder to ping node2 this time i pinged but i can not ping node1?

Re: How to solve this problem?HP-Unix rp8400
Hi,
#ioscan -fnC lan
you need to assign lan card i/o addresses to the partitions while craeting, which by default detect the respective lan card while booting
